“Explorations in Silk”
On exhibit November 2 – November 27
About 25 years ago, four silk artists came together in San Diego to promote their art form through exhibits, workshops, and community outreach. Since that time, the San Diego Silk Guild has grown to over 35 members who fulfill this mission with their passion for silk painting. Painting on silk is a unique art form that offers unlimited pathways to artistic expression. Wall hangings, quilted pieces, wax batiks, Japanese shibori, collage and multimedia work, three-dimensional pieces, painting, and beautiful wearables all reflect the variety of techniques used by silk artists. Using high quality silk fabric and dyes specially formulated for this material, silk artists find endless possibilities in transforming a white canvas into the finished work of art imagined by its creator. The artists of the San Diego Silk Guild demonstrate this diversity in silk art with each offering a personal variation of technique that reflects the artist’s unique vision.
The San Diego Silk Guild is a chapter of Silk Painters International.
